Latest Patents: Mueller's most recent patents showcase his expertise in developing advanced materials. One of his notable inventions is the "Knitted Spacer Fabric." This innovative fabric features an upper knitted cover layer and a lower knitted cover layer, which are interconnected by pile threads. What sets this fabric apart is its use of at least two different pile threads having dissimilar elasticity properties, allowing for unique applications in various industries.

Another significant invention is the "Lubricating Element and Lubricating Unit." This design addresses the needs of rolling element tracks, particularly in linear systems. The lubricating element is composed of a lubricant-storing material, possessing an application section that contacts a rolling element bearing surface to supply lubricant. Additionally, the storage region is cleverly designed with a recess, enhancing its functionality and performance.
